Chuncho Macaw Clay lick is a singular sight. You will see countless brightly coloured Macaws and Parrots flock to try to eat the clay. The clay incorporates a mineral information that helps them to flush out the toxins from their system.

Clay licks are steep walls of crimson clay because of erosion along riverbanks. The title arises from the animals they attract: parrots who flock there through the hundreds to eat the clay every single early morning.

The Tambopata Analysis Centre is found in close proximity to amongst the biggest macaw clay licks within the Amazon Rainforest and scientists learning macaw behavior use the lodge to be a base.
